5 overrides of GetMembersUnordered
Microsoft.CodeAnalysis.CSharp (5)
Symbols\Retargeting\RetargetingNamedTypeSymbol.cs (1)
130
internal override ImmutableArray<Symbol>
GetMembersUnordered
()
Symbols\Retargeting\RetargetingNamespaceSymbol.cs (1)
96
internal override ImmutableArray<Symbol>
GetMembersUnordered
()
Symbols\Source\SourceMemberContainerSymbol.cs (1)
1385
internal override ImmutableArray<Symbol>
GetMembersUnordered
()
Symbols\Source\SourceNamespaceSymbol.cs (1)
129
internal override ImmutableArray<Symbol>
GetMembersUnordered
()
Symbols\SubstitutedNamedTypeSymbol.cs (1)
259
internal sealed override ImmutableArray<Symbol>
GetMembersUnordered
()
64 references to GetMembersUnordered
Microsoft.CodeAnalysis.CSharp (48)
Binder\Binder_Lookup.cs (1)
1333
return nsOrType.
GetMembersUnordered
();
Binder\WithUsingNamespacesAndTypesBinder.cs (1)
207
foreach (var member in namespaceSymbol.NamespaceOrType.
GetMembersUnordered
())
Compilation\CSharpCompilation.cs (1)
1779
AddEntryPointCandidates(entryPointCandidates, mainType.
GetMembersUnordered
());
Compilation\SyntaxTreeSemanticModel.cs (1)
1761
var collection = name != null ? container.GetMembers(name) : container.
GetMembersUnordered
();
Compiler\ClsComplianceChecker.cs (5)
205
foreach (var m in symbol.
GetMembersUnordered
())
223
foreach (var m in symbol.
GetMembersUnordered
())
260
foreach (var m in symbol.
GetMembersUnordered
())
816
foreach (Symbol member in @interface.
GetMembersUnordered
())
831
foreach (Symbol member in baseType.
GetMembersUnordered
())
Compiler\MethodCompiler.cs (1)
392
foreach (var s in symbol.
GetMembersUnordered
())
Emitter\NoPia\EmbeddedTypesManager.cs (1)
254
foreach (Symbol member in namedType.
GetMembersUnordered
())
FlowAnalysis\DefiniteAssignment.cs (1)
2486
foreach (var symbol in namedType.
GetMembersUnordered
())
FlowAnalysis\EmptyStructTypeCache.cs (2)
144
foreach (var member in type.OriginalDefinition.
GetMembersUnordered
())
183
foreach (var member in type.OriginalDefinition.
GetMembersUnordered
())
FlowAnalysis\NullableWalker.cs (6)
617
? method.ContainingType.
GetMembersUnordered
().SelectManyAsArray(
627
foreach (var member in method.ContainingType.
GetMembersUnordered
())
981
=> containingType.
GetMembersUnordered
().SelectManyAsArray(predicate: SymbolExtensions.IsRequired, selector: getAllMembersToBeDefaulted),
987
=> containingType.
GetMembersUnordered
().SelectAsArray(getFieldSymbolToBeInitialized),
998
var members = containingType.
GetMembersUnordered
();
4035
var members = ((NamedTypeSymbol)type).
GetMembersUnordered
();
Symbols\AnonymousTypes\PublicSymbols\AnonymousManager.TypeOrDelegatePublicSymbol.cs (1)
48
return this.
GetMembersUnordered
();
Symbols\AnonymousTypes\SynthesizedSymbols\AnonymousType.TypeOrDelegateTemplateSymbol.cs (1)
120
return this.
GetMembersUnordered
();
Symbols\BaseTypeAnalysis.cs (1)
93
foreach (var member in type.
GetMembersUnordered
())
Symbols\ErrorTypeSymbol.cs (1)
169
return this.
GetMembersUnordered
();
Symbols\MergedNamespaceSymbol.cs (2)
175
foreach (var child in ns.
GetMembersUnordered
())
228
return ImmutableArray.CreateRange<NamedTypeSymbol>(
GetMembersUnordered
().OfType<NamedTypeSymbol>());
Symbols\Metadata\PE\MetadataDecoder.cs (2)
494
foreach (Symbol member in typeSymbol.
GetMembersUnordered
())
519
foreach (Symbol member in typeSymbol.
GetMembersUnordered
())
Symbols\Metadata\PE\PENamedTypeSymbol.cs (1)
1155
return this.
GetMembersUnordered
();
Symbols\NamedTypeSymbol.cs (4)
353
? this.
GetMembersUnordered
()
619
foreach (var member in
GetMembersUnordered
())
700
/// <see cref="NamespaceOrTypeSymbol.
GetMembersUnordered
"/>.
704
return
GetMembersUnordered
().Where(IsInstanceFieldOrEvent);
Symbols\Retargeting\RetargetingNamedTypeSymbol.cs (1)
132
return this.RetargetingTranslator.Retarget(_underlyingType.
GetMembersUnordered
());
Symbols\Retargeting\RetargetingNamespaceSymbol.cs (1)
98
return RetargetMembers(_underlyingNamespace.
GetMembersUnordered
());
Symbols\Source\SourceAssemblySymbol.cs (1)
2056
foreach (var member in ns.
GetMembersUnordered
())
Symbols\Source\SourceMemberContainerSymbol.cs (1)
2599
foreach (var m in t.
GetMembersUnordered
())
Symbols\Source\SourceModuleSymbol.cs (2)
167
foreach (Symbol s in ns.
GetMembersUnordered
())
557
foreach (var member in ns.
GetMembersUnordered
())
Symbols\SubstitutedNamedTypeSymbol.cs (2)
265
foreach (var t in OriginalDefinition.
GetMembersUnordered
())
275
foreach (var t in OriginalDefinition.
GetMembersUnordered
())
Symbols\Synthesized\Records\SynthesizedRecordBaseEquals.cs (1)
76
ContainingType.
GetMembersUnordered
().OfType<SynthesizedRecordObjEquals>().Single(),
Symbols\Synthesized\Records\SynthesizedRecordEquals.cs (1)
111
MethodSymbol? baseEquals = ContainingType.
GetMembersUnordered
().OfType<SynthesizedRecordBaseEquals>().Single().OverriddenMethod;
Symbols\Synthesized\Records\SynthesizedRecordPropertySymbol.cs (1)
95
parameter.ContainingType.
GetMembersUnordered
().Any((s, parameter) => (s as SynthesizedRecordPropertySymbol)?.BackingParameter == (object)parameter, parameter);
Symbols\Synthesized\SynthesizedContainer.cs (1)
134
internal override ImmutableArray<Symbol> GetEarlyAttributeDecodingMembers() => this.
GetMembersUnordered
();
Symbols\TypeSymbol.cs (2)
2239
foreach (var member in this.
GetMembersUnordered
())
2348
foreach (var member in this.
GetMembersUnordered
())
Symbols\VarianceSafety.cs (1)
45
foreach (Symbol member in interfaceType.
GetMembersUnordered
())
Microsoft.CodeAnalysis.CSharp.Emit.UnitTests (6)
CodeGen\CodeGenAsyncIteratorTests.cs (2)
1595
type.
GetMembersUnordered
().Select(m => m.ToTestDisplayString()));
2134
type.
GetMembersUnordered
().Select(m => m.ToTestDisplayString()));
CodeGen\CodeGenTupleTest.cs (4)
12711
m1Tuple.
GetMembersUnordered
().ToTestDisplayStrings().ToImmutableArray().Sort());
16586
((ErrorTypeSymbol)((Symbols.PublicModel.ErrorTypeSymbol)xSymbol).UnderlyingSymbol).
GetMembersUnordered
().ToTestDisplayStrings().ToImmutableArray().Sort());
16625
((ErrorTypeSymbol)((Symbols.PublicModel.ErrorTypeSymbol)xSymbol).UnderlyingSymbol).
GetMembersUnordered
().ToTestDisplayStrings().ToImmutableArray().Sort());
28025
retargetingValueTupleType.
GetMembersUnordered
().OrderBy(m => m.Name).ToTestDisplayStrings());
Microsoft.CodeAnalysis.CSharp.Semantic.UnitTests (2)
Semantics\NativeIntegerTests.cs (1)
475
var unorderedMembers = type.
GetMembersUnordered
();
Semantics\RecordTests.cs (1)
9985
var b1Ctor = comp.GetTypeByMetadataName("B1")!.
GetMembersUnordered
().OfType<SynthesizedPrimaryConstructor>().Single();
Microsoft.CodeAnalysis.CSharp.Symbol.UnitTests (8)
CrossLanguageTests.cs (2)
38
Assert.Empty(t.
GetMembersUnordered
().Where(x => x.Kind == SymbolKind.Method && !x.CanBeReferencedByName));
39
Assert.False(t.
GetMembersUnordered
().Where(x => x.Kind == SymbolKind.Property).First().CanBeReferencedByName); //there's only one.
DocumentationComments\DocumentationCommentIDTests.cs (3)
351
var method = type.
GetMembersUnordered
().OfType<MethodSymbol>().Single(m => m.MethodKind == MethodKind.ExplicitInterfaceImplementation);
352
var property = type.
GetMembersUnordered
().OfType<PropertySymbol>().Single();
353
var @event = type.
GetMembersUnordered
().OfType<EventSymbol>().Single();
Symbols\Metadata\MetadataMemberTests.cs (1)
482
AssertEx.None(type.
GetMembersUnordered
(), symbol => symbol.Name.StartsWith("_VtblGap", StringComparison.Ordinal));
Symbols\Retargeting\NoPia.cs (2)
299
Assert.Equal(2, localTypes1.GlobalNamespace.
GetMembersUnordered
().Length);
311
Assert.Equal(2, localTypes2.GlobalNamespace.
GetMembersUnordered
().Length);